Equation of a line is 3x−4y+10=0. Find its
(a) Slope
(b) x− and y− intercepts.
Solution
As we know that the above statement is connected to the linear equation in two variables. An equation of the form px+qy=r, where p,q and r are real numbers and the variables p and q are not equivalent to zero, is called a linear equation in two variables. The slope intercept form of a linear equation has the following term where the equation is solved for y in terms of x:y=a+bx, b is the slope and a is a constant term.
Complete step by step solution:
As per the question we have the equation 3x−4y+10=0.
We know that the slope intercept form of the equation is y=mx+b, where mis the slope and b is the y -intercept value. Let us first write the above question in its general form.
We can write the above equation as 4y=3x+10; by isolating the term y, we have y=43x+410.
Now by comparing this from the general form of the straight line, we know that m is the slope, so it gives us m=43, it is the slope of the line.
We know that y intercept is defined as value of y at x=0, so from the equation we have: y=43×0+410.
Upon adding the values it gives us y=410=25, it is the y−intercept.
Similarly, We know that xintercept is defined as value of x at y=0, so by putting this in the equation we have:0=43x+410.
On further solving we have 0=43x+10. We can take the denominator to the right hand side i.e. 3x=10
So it gives us the value x=−310.
Hence this is the x− intercept of the equation.
Therefore, slope of the given equation is is 43 and x-intercept is 310, y-intercept is 25.
